TTSH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2022 in Review
83 of the 5,806 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Tile Shop Holdings (TTSH) for Q3 2022, worth a combined $56M — down 18% from $68M a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 17 funds closed out of TTSH and 16 opened new positions — a net loss of 1 holder — while 28 trimmed existing stakes and 27 added.
The largest buyer was Cannell Capital, adding an estimated $4.98M. The largest seller was Kanen Wealth Management, cutting an estimated $12.1M.
